Your Guide to Modern Web Advancement: Patterns and Best Practices
In the swiftly progressing landscape of web growth, recognizing the latest trends and ideal practices is necessary for developing pertinent and interesting electronic experiences. Secret factors to consider such as user experience, receptive layout, and ease of access are not just optional yet integral to the success of contemporary applications.
Emerging Technologies in Internet Growth
The evolution of web growth is marked by an unrelenting search of development, driven by the need to improve individual experience and streamline processes. Arising technologies continue to improve the landscape, supplying developers powerful devices to develop even more dynamic and responsive applications. Key among these innovations are Modern Web Applications (PWAs), which mix the very best of web and mobile apps, offering offline functionality and boosted efficiency.
One more substantial improvement is the increase of Expert system (AI) and Machine Understanding (ML), which allow customized user experiences and data-driven decision-making. These technologies facilitate chatbots, referral systems, and improved search functionalities, hence changing how customers communicate with web applications.
In addition, the adoption of frameworks like React, Vue.js, and Angular has actually changed front-end growth, advertising modular design and reliable state management. On the backside, serverless architecture and microservices promote scalability and flexibility, permitting designers to focus on writing code without handling framework.
Value of Customer Experience
Individual experience (UX) has actually become a crucial focus in internet development, especially as arising technologies improve interactions. A favorable UX not only enhances individual fulfillment however additionally drives engagement, retention, and conversions. ecommerce web development perth. In a significantly affordable digital landscape, services must prioritize UX to differentiate themselves and satisfy customer assumptions
Effective UX style is rooted in recognizing user needs and habits. This entails performing complete study, developing user personalities, and making use of usability testing to collect understandings. By doing so, programmers can create user-friendly user interfaces that promote smooth navigating and decrease rubbing factors.
In addition, a well-designed UX can considerably affect a site's performance metrics. Studies have shown that individuals are more probable to desert a website if they encounter bad functionality or extreme packing times. On the other hand, a streamlined, user-centric style can result in lower bounce rates and raised time invested in the website.
Embracing Responsive Design
In today's varied digital landscape, welcoming responsive layout is necessary for making certain optimum user experiences throughout different devices. With a boosting number of customers accessing web sites through smart devices, tablets, and desktop computers, a responsive layout method enables material to adjust effortlessly to different display sizes and alignments.
Responsive style employs fluid grids, adaptable images, and CSS media inquiries to create a dynamic format that changes in real-time. This technique not only improves usability however additionally contributes to improved search engine positions, as internet search engine favor websites that give a consistent experience across tools. Additionally, receptive layout reduces the demand for multiple variations of an internet site, enhancing upkeep and updates.
Additionally, responsive style promotes better involvement by providing a tailored experience, keeping individuals on the website longer and lowering bounce prices. As customer behavior continues to progress, purchasing responsive design is critical for organizations intending to enhance consumer complete satisfaction and drive conversions. In summary, taking on receptive design is not merely a trend; it is a fundamental practice that aligns with the expectations of modern individuals, making certain ease of access and performance regardless of the gadget they select to utilize.
Access in Internet Growth
Developing an internet site that is both receptive and obtainable is crucial for reaching a broader audience. Ease of access in web development ensures that all customers, no matter of their capacities or handicaps, can properly involve with digital content. This includes people with aesthetic, acoustic, cognitive, or electric motor disabilities.
To achieve accessibility, developers should follow the Internet Content Access Standards (WCAG), which offer a structure for making web content much more perceivable, operable, understandable, and durable. Key techniques include making use of semantic HTML components, supplying alternative text for pictures, ensuring enough shade contrast, and enabling key-board navigating.
Additionally, applying ARIA useful reference (Available Abundant Web Applications) features can improve access, especially for vibrant web content and find out advanced interface. Testing with genuine customers, including those with impairments, is essential to identify possible barriers and improve individual experience.
Eventually, focusing on access not just enhances compliance with legal requirements yet additionally promotes inclusivity, allowing organizations to attach with a broader audience. As web growth proceeds to advance, installing access right into the layout and growth procedure is not simply an ideal technique; it is an honest responsibility that benefits everyone.
The Rise of Progressive Web Applications
A significant shift in internet growth has actually emerged with the increase of Progressive Web Apps (PWAs), which seamlessly combine the very best attributes of mobile applications and standard internet sites (ecommerce web development perth). PWAs are made to supply customers with a quick, reliable, and interesting experience, no matter of their web connection. This is achieved via solution workers, which enable offline capabilities and background syncing, making sure that individuals can access material even in low-connectivity scenarios
PWAs additionally leverage responsive layout browse around this web-site principles, guaranteeing that they operate efficiently across a selection of tools and display sizes. This flexibility is crucial in a period where consumers increasingly rely upon mobile devices for their on-line activities. In addition, PWAs eliminate the requirement for separate application store installments, enabling easier and much more accessible circulation.
The benefits prolong to businesses. PWAs can result in boosted user involvement, higher conversion rates, and lowered development costs by preserving a solitary codebase for both internet and mobile systems. As companies aim to enhance customer experiences while maximizing efficiency, the fostering of Progressive Internet Apps proceeds to grow, solidifying their standing as a crucial pattern in modern web advancement.
Final Thought
In verdict, modern-day internet development necessitates a multifaceted method that includes arising modern technologies, user experience, responsive design, availability, and the execution of Dynamic Internet Applications. Sticking to these fads and best practices not only enhances customer engagement but likewise fosters inclusivity, making sure that digital web content comes to diverse audiences. By prioritizing these aspects, programmers can develop impactful applications that satisfy the developing demands of individuals in a significantly electronic landscape.